logo

Output 40ecfc4816cd067e8141e96d664e1f7b6fadb90eb24c905fc8c1764c38ee3c7f:4

value
1569274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 541e222486214971137fda7baccd745b6c2987f0 OP_EQUAL
address
39MnnMsp3SbGDPfpswdEdzkqFZ4crpdm6T
transaction
40ecfc4816cd067e8141e96d664e1f7b6fadb90eb24c905fc8c1764c38ee3c7f